Purpose of Job

This position performs daily branch office operations, processes listings and sales contracts, compiles buyer/seller guides, creates basic marketing materials, and sets up and maintains client databases to support sales associates, management, and branch administrative staff. It may also provide work direction for clerical staff and coordinate daily general office activities.

Job Duties and Responsibilities (Essential Job Functions)
  • Receive, process, and review listing and sales contracts; maintain files, ensure accuracy and timely preparation of all paperwork, record and maintain sold records, prepare and generate reports, and transfer earnest money. (40‑50%)
  • Perform daily branch office operations including maintaining office appearance, processing mail, accounts payable/receivable, reconciling petty cash, maintaining office supplies and forms. Answer switchboard, greet visitors, schedule appointments, and assist with client communications. (30‑35%)
  • Assist in training new office personnel; provide work direction to other office staff; train new sales agents on office equipment and computer programs; act as a liaison between sales associates and office management; provide support to office management and backup support for clerical staff as needed. (10‑15%)
  • Create brochures, flyers/postcards, sign‑in sheets, and promotional pieces; create letters to clients, presentation materials, sales associate introduction cards, and temporary business cards; assemble buyer and seller guides; set up and update client and customer sphere of influence databases; create farming database for sales associates. (10‑15%)
  • Process license application paperwork for new, renewing, and transferred sales associates; ensure all paperwork is completed and processed in a timely manner. (0‑5%)
  • Perform any additional responsibilities as requested or assigned. (0‑5%)
